在包含Azure DevOps门户中的交叉仓库策略的最新更新之后,即使我是组织和项目的所有者,我也无法添加项目范围的分支保护。
是否需要将任何特殊权限分配给我的用户?
谢谢, 维。
答案 0 :(得分:1)
是否需要将任何特殊权限分配给我的用户?
您应该检查用户的访问级别,如果它们是涉众级别,则他们将无权添加项目范围的分支保护。
如果在“组织设置”->“用户”上将我的用户设置为涉众级别:
然后,我的用户将获得以下状态:您无权制定项目范围的分支机构政策:
因此,要解决此问题,您应该为用户分配更高的访问级别,例如基本。
希望这会有所帮助。
答案 1 :(得分:1)
我通过保留所有组(“项目管理员”组除外)解决了该问题。
这是基于@ViMans评论。
报价:
我已经意识到问题与属于的用户有关 具有不同访问级别的不同组。例如:一个组织 属于贡献者组的管理员,它将保持最多 基于最小特权原则的限制性访问级别